  • Read Across America Day

      Books can take us anywhere: to any time, any place, or culture. Ninety-one percent of Americans say that libraries and reading are important to their communities. (2013, Library Services in the Digital Age.) Florida Department of State recorded that over 57% of Floridians have a library card, which is more than 12.3 million book-readers.   • CAC Pitcher of the Week

    [caption id="attachment_81632" align="alignnone" width="300"] Dakota Kulis Pitcher of the week[/caption] CAC Press Release: #FNU Softball secures pitcher of the Week! Congrats to Dakota Kulis. Florida National University Junior Dakota Kulis has earned the Continental Athletic Conference pitcher of the week award.
